Running events
Events can raise awareness of your campaign, raise money, reward your core crowd and create opportunities for media coverage.
But they can be time-consuming to organise, so if you can piggyback on existing events where you can make an ask, or have a supporter ask for you, even better.

Boosted Stories: Vallé
Tali Enjalas Jenkinson makes music under the name Vallé. The rapper spent the first few months of his life in Port Moresby, Papua New Guinea and moved to Aoteoaroa New Zealand with his father for life-saving medical treatment when he was just eight months old. Vallé is now based in Ōtautahi Christchurch.

Boosted Stories: Māpura Studios
Māpura Studios is a creative space and art therapy centre in central Auckland Tāmaki Makaurau. The project works with over 200 adults and children every week, offering art classes and art therapy programmes for people living with disability and diversity. The studio is also the only organisation that is contracted to deliver art therapy programmes to inmates at Auckland Prison – changing paths and making an impact through art and creativity.
